45 1.1 cgd /*
46 1.1 cgd * lprm - remove the current user's spool entry
47 1.1 cgd *
48 1.1 cgd * lprm [-] [[job #] [user] ...]
49 1.1 cgd *
50 1.1 cgd * Using information in the lock file, lprm will kill the
51 1.1 cgd * currently active daemon (if necessary), remove the associated files,
52 1.1 cgd * and startup a new daemon. Priviledged users may remove anyone's spool
53 1.1 cgd * entries, otherwise one can only remove their own.
54 1.1 cgd */
